HTML5与CSS3的魅力如何打造现代网页的艺术之城
HTML5与CSS3的魅力:如何打造现代网页的艺术之城?
HTML5新特性的应用
结合视频和音频元素,实现更加丰富多彩的媒体体验。
利用canvas API绘制图形,让网页变得更加生动。
使用地理定位API,为用户提供个性化服务。
CSS3样式的创新
使用渐变、阴影等效果,使设计更具视觉冲击力。
应用变换和过渡属性,提升交互体验。
通过媒体查询优化响应式设计,以适应不同设备屏幕大小。
移动优先设计原则
采用流畅简洁的布局,确保移动端页面快速加载。
优化触控友好的交互方式,便于手指操作。
考虑到电池续航问题,对资源进行节约处理。
跨浏览器兼容性的解决策略
遵循W3C标准,同时考虑各大浏览器支持差异性。
使用modernizr.js等工具检测浏览器能力,然后进行相应调整。
在开发前后测试,不断修正可能出现的问题。
前端性能优化技巧
实现代码压缩减少传输时间,加快页面加载速度。使用CDN加速静态资源。避免重复请求减少HTTP请求数量。采用图片懒加载技术,只在可视区域内加载图片内容。利用缓存机制存储经常访问或不经常变化的资源,以提高再次访问时性能表现。
前端安全最佳实践
避免使用未知来源库或框架,以防止潜在安全漏洞攻击。在服务器端对敏感数据进行加密处理,并严格控制跨站脚本(XSS)攻击。在客户端验证输入数据以防止SQL注入攻击或其他类型的恶意行为。此外,要及时更新软件并安装安全补丁来抵御已知漏洞。